Background

Founded in 1863, Saint Mary's is a residential campus nestled 20 miles east of San Francisco in the picturesque Moraga Valley. Based in the Catholic, Lasallian and Liberal Arts traditions, Saint Mary's currently enrolls more than 4,000 students from diverse backgrounds in undergraduate and graduate programs. The De La Salle Christian Brothers, the largest teaching order of the Roman Catholic Church, guide the spiritual and academic character of the College.

As a comprehensive and independent institution, Saint Mary's offers undergraduate and graduate programs integrating liberal and professional education. Saint Mary's reputation for excellence, innovation, and responsiveness in education stems from its vibrant heritage as a Catholic, Lasallian and Liberal Arts institution. An outstanding, committed faculty and staff that value shared inquiry, integrative learning, and student interaction bring these traditions to life in the 21st century. The College is committed to the educational benefits of diversity.

Responsibilities
Saint Mary's College of California is seeking a skilled Student Services Manager to provide support to and intervention for School of Liberal Art (SOLA) and School of Science (SOS) Graduate and Professional Study students. This person will report directly to the SOLA Assistant Dean of Finance and Administration. The Student Services Manager will be responsible for executing a variety of duties and working with a diverse group of internal and external constituents. The ideal candidate is highly self-motivated, organized, energetic, detail-oriented, demonstrates sound judgment, and possesses excellent written and oral communication skills. The role requires someone capable of managing their workload and prioritizing tasks in a fast-paced environment. This is an excellent opportunity to join a high-performing, collaborative, and evolving team.

The Student Services Manager will work with graduate students to resolve issues related to financial aid, student accounts, program and College orientation, registration, and other academic and non-academic concerns. Address any academic or administrative concerns that faculty or students are unable to resolve, liaising with relevant programs and offices.

Monitor students' academic progress and keep students and advisors updated on relevant timelines, issues and concerns. Regularly review student files through auditing and Colleague to ensure students are meeting all academic and graduation requirements. This position will liaise with the Registrar's office to post degrees and provide regular updates to ensure program directors, advisors and students have access to current information on student academic progress, and track and maintain individual student records in the Google drive.

Experience and Qualifications
QUALIFICATIONS:

Education: REQUIRED: Bachelor's Degree PREFERRED: Master's Degree

Experience: (years required and applicable field of experience): Preference for at least one year of experience interacting with students, faculty and administration in higher education or in a related industry that involves academic and/or administrative processes.

Skills/Abilities: (e.g. computer skills, written & verbal skills, trades, laws, procedures, technical) Supportive, student-centered approach; understanding and appreciation of the unique needs of graduate and professional studies students; demonstrated excellence in using Google suite, Windows operating systems, Microsoft Office, and email; significant experience working with databases and admission platforms; ability to handle multiple tasks and assignments and meet demanding deadlines; remain calm under pressure, establish priorities and work in an organized manner with emphasis on detail and accuracy; ability to work independently without close supervision and as a member of a team, seek consultation when necessary; high level of reliability, creativity and commitment to maintain confidentiality; ability to work cooperatively and effectively with all members of a culturally diverse campus community; understanding of academic policy and administrative operations; ability to cultivate and maintain partnerships with diverse individuals, offices and programs; understanding of and commitment to further the College's mission; ability to respond promptly, kindly, and effectively to the flow of traffic, even during high-volume times when there might be multiple clients in a crowded space expecting a multiplicity of types of service.

Licenses & Certifications (e.g. CPA, RN, etc.): REQUIRED: PREFERRED:

Other Requirements: (e.g. travel, weekend/evening work) Occasional evening and weekend work in support of special events.
